LBX is a CFD broker with a clear focus on Forex and cryptocurrencies, offering a standard but practical set of trading solutions. The broker is primarily suitable for experienced and active traders who value high leverage, support for MetaTrader 4 and 5, fast payment operations, and a simple account structure. LBX may also be of interest to traders using algorithmic strategies and those who do not need educational materials and advanced analytics.

Pros and Cons of LBX

Pros

  1. Convenient conditions for Forex and crypto trading: about 140 CFD instruments with a focus on currencies and cryptocurrencies.
  2. Clear account lineup (Standard and Raw Spread), support for MT4 and MT5, algorithmic trading.
  3. Fast deposits and withdrawals, a wide choice of payment methods, often with no broker-side fees.
  4. Leverage up to 1:1000 and negative balance protection.
  5. 24/7 technical support with multiple contact channels and generally positive reviews.

Cons

  1. Offshore regulation (FSC Mauritius), with no Tier-1 regulator licenses.
  2. No stocks or investment products; the market selection is narrower than with universal brokers.
  3. Almost no educational materials—only an FAQ.

Regulators

IC Markets

IC Markets operates under the regulation of several jurisdictions, including ASIC in Australia, CySEC in Cyprus, and SFSA in the Seychelles, indicating a high degree of regulation.

LBX

LBX is an offshore CFD broker from the Libertex Group, operating via MAEX Limited under the supervision of the FSC Mauritius. There is regulation, but it is not Tier-1; the level of protection is basic, without “premium” oversight.

Pros

  1. Active FSC Mauritius license
  2. Negative balance protection

Cons

  1. Offshore jurisdiction (not Tier-1)
  2. Short track record of the LBX brand
